This Healthy Ways to Express Ourselves Assembly PowerPoint is a ready-to-deliver resource that helps pupils understand the importance of expressing feelings safely, respectfully, and positively. Perfect for whole-school assemblies, wellbeing days, PSHE introductions, or emotional literacy focus weeks, this resource supports children in recognising emotions and using healthy strategies to communicate their needs.

What the resource contains

✔ Full assembly-ready PowerPoint, including:

Warm-up discussion prompts – Simple, engaging questions to help pupils think about emotions and self-expression from the very start.

What does “expressing ourselves” mean? – Child-friendly explanations that build vocabulary and understanding.

Why expressing emotions is important – Links to friendships, mental wellbeing, behaviour choices, and resilience.

Healthy vs. unhealthy ways to express feelings – Clearly explained examples that help pupils understand the difference.

Common emotions and safe ways to share them – Supports emotional literacy and regulation across all age groups.

Practical strategies – Such as talking to a trusted adult, journaling, creative arts, physical movement, breathing techniques, and positive communication.

Real-life mini-scenarios – Ideal for quick “hands-up” responses or turn-and-talk moments during assemblies.

Reflection slide – Encourages pupils to consider: “What is one healthy way I can express myself today?”
